EuS2 is a europium disulfide ceramic compound belonging to the rare-earth chalcogenide family, characterized by a dense crystalline structure. This material exists primarily in research and developmental contexts rather than widespread industrial production, with investigation focused on its potential applications in optoelectronics, magnetic devices, and solid-state physics due to europium's unique luminescent and magnetic properties. Engineers considering EuS2 would target specialized applications where rare-earth chemistry provides functional advantages—such as optical materials or magnetic refrigeration systems—where conventional alternatives cannot match the material's physical characteristics.
